Incorporation of Prior Constraints in Tomographic Reconstructions from Coded Images
The study of coded-aperture imaging has usually centered on the restoration of planar objects from planar coded images. The concept has been generalized to the problem of restoring a 3-dimensional object from a planar coded image. These two tasks are illustrated in Figure 1.
